EFSC General Engineering Technology Associate’s Program

All of the 10 students who graduated with a Associate’s in engineering tech from EFSC in 2021 were men.

undefined

The majority of the students with this major are white. About 80% of 2021 graduates were in this category.

The following table and chart show the ethnic background for students who recently graduated from Eastern Florida State College with a associate's in engineering tech.
